A “cookie” is a small piece of information sent by a web server to store on a web browser so it can later be read back from that browser. This is useful for having the browser recustomer some specific information. An example is when a browser stores your passwords and user IDs. They are also used to store preferences of start pages.

Cookies are used to make informed guesses about you. They can be used to access information about your web activities including things like sites you’ve visited, passwords and purchases you’ve made. Companies can only make guesses about who you are because cookies do not necessarily contain personal information about you. Cookies alone are not invasive of your privacy and actually provide benefits to you. Much of what you find on the web today is free because advertising, similar to television and radio, supports it. Advertising, in part, is driven by the information contained in cookies. Cookies provide an effective way for the web sites you visit to personalize your experience when you visit them. In fact, many sites actually require that a cookie be “dropped” on your computer in order for these sites to recognize you and work properly when you visit them.

Our Use of Clear GIFs

EnCirca sometimes uses a common technology called a clear gif or action tags. A clear gif (graphic interface format) is a small graphic image that is a 1×1 pixel placed on our web site, in banner ads, and/or in e-mail communications. A clear gif provides us with important information about how customers use our web site and respond to our e-mail communications, such as whether someone is using an e-mail reader that understands HTML e-mail messages. This information helps us understand the effectiveness of our web-based communications and improve it’s effectiveness. GDPR Policy

The European Union General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) requires a business to limit collection of personal data and to safeguard personal data in its possession; businesses must also comply with requests from individuals related to access, rectification, erasure, and portability of their personal data.

GDPR will be enforceable EU-wide from 25 May 2018, and will apply each time we collect, store, or share personal data relating to a European citizen or resident, or managed in Europe.

On 17 May 2018, the ICANN Board approved a Temporary Specification, to establish temporary requirements for how ICANN and contracted parties will continue to comply with existing contractual and policy requirements while also complying with GDPR.

The Temporary Specification is effective as of 25 May 2018, though we note that the new gTLD Registry Agreement allows for Registry Operators to be afforded a “reasonable period of time” to comply with any new Temporary Policy following ICANN providing notice of such.

Although EnCirca will continue to collect registrant information for our records, ICANN Whois records will redact all identifying information for a customer. This includes all registrant, admin, technical, and billing names, emails and addresses. So, for example, the only identifying information for encirca.com is:

California Consumer Privacy Act of 2018 (“CCPA”)

This section only applies to California residents. Where we collect, process, use, or disclose personal information that is subject to the CCPA, we are committed to processing your personal information in a transparent and fair manner and in compliance with the CCPA. This section describes the rights California residents have in relation to your personal information and provides the notices required by the CCPA.

YOUR CCPA RIGHTS

The CCPA grants California residents the rights described below.

Right to Know General Collection and Use of Personal Information (Access Request) . Under the CCPA, California residents have the right to request that EnCirca disclose what information we have collected, used, disclosed, or sold over the past 12 months. Once we receive and confirm your verifiable consumer request for such information, we will disclose to you, based on your specific request:

  • The categories of personal information we collected about you over the past 12 months;
  • The categories of sources from which the personal information is collected over the past 12 months;
  • The business or commercial purpose for collecting or selling that personal information over the past 12 months;
  • The categories of third parties with whom we shared your personal information over the past 12 months;
  • If we disclosed your personal information for a business purpose, the personal information categories that each category of recipients obtained; and/or
  • If we sold your personal information for a business purpose, the personal information categories that each category of recipients purchased.

Right to Know Specific Pieces of Personal Information (Data Portability) . Upon your verified request for such information, we will disclose to you certain specific pieces of personal information we have collected about you over the past 12 months.

Right to Request Deletion . You have the right to request that we delete any of your personal information that we have collected from you and retained, subject to certain exceptions. Once we receive and confirm your verifiable consumer request, we will delete your personal information from our records, and direct our service providers to do the same, unless an exception applies.

Some of the exceptions that would allow us to deny a request for deletion include if the information is necessary for us or our service provider(s) to do the following:

  • Complete the transaction for which we collected the personal information, provide a good or service that you requested, take actions reasonably anticipated within the context of our ongoing business relationship with you, or otherwise perform a contract we have with you.
  • Detect security incidents, protect against malicious, deceptive, fraudulent, or illegal activity, or prosecute those responsible for such activities.
  • Debug products to identify and repair errors that impair existing intended functionality.
  • Exercise free speech, ensure the right of another consumer to exercise their free speech rights, or exercise another right provided for by law.
  • Comply with the California Electronic Communications Privacy Act (Cal. Penal Code § 1546 et. seq.).
  • Engage in public or peer-reviewed scientific, historical, or statistical research in the public interest that adheres to all other applicable ethics and privacy laws, when the information’s deletion may likely render impossible or seriously impair the research’s achievement, if you previously provided informed consent.
  • Enable solely internal uses that are reasonably aligned with consumer expectations based on your relationship with us.
  • Comply with a legal obligation.
  • Make other internal and lawful uses of that information that are compatible with the context in which you provided it.

Right to Opt-Out of Sale of Personal Information . You have the right to direct businesses that sell personal information to not sell your personal information (the “right to opt-out”). EnCirca currently does not sell personal information of California residents to third parties, including the personal information of California residents who are under 16 years of age.

Right to Non-Discrimination . You have the right not to be discriminated against for having exercised the rights established by the CCPA. We will not discriminate against you for exercising any of your CCPA rights. Unless permitted by the CCPA, we will not:

  • Deny you goods or services.
  • Charge you different prices or rates for goods or services, including through granting discounts or other benefits or imposing penalties.
  • Provide you a different level or quality of goods or services.
  • Suggest that you may receive a different price or rate for goods or services or a different level or quality of goods or services.
